From 6bac751c4c6b598f22321dfd3794d68cf904603d Mon Sep 17 00:00:00 2001 From: Stefan Agner Date: Tue, 13 May 2025 14:42:59 +0200 Subject: [PATCH] Log DNS resolver initialization errors with critical severity (#5884) To make sure we learn about DNS resolver initialization errors, lets log them with critical severity. This was the original intention of PR #5882. --- supervisor/coresys.py |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/supervisor/coresys.py b/supervisor/coresys.py index 7ddda4ce9..d523bab9d 100644 --- a/supervisor/coresys.py +++ b/supervisor/coresys.py @@ -130,7 +130,9 @@ class CoreSys: resolver._resolver.nameservers, ) except AresError as err: - _LOGGER.exception("Unable to initialize async DNS resolver: %s", err) + _LOGGER.critical( + "Unable to initialize async DNS resolver: %s", err, exc_info=True + ) resolver = aiohttp.ThreadedResolver(loop=self.loop) connector = aiohttp.TCPConnector(loop=self.loop, resolver=resolver)